If you assume that they don’t have scorch and pillage in hand, you still can’t just mindlessly patrol with everything. You need to take this turn to accomplish a few objectives:

  • Making sure Midori can’t suicide into one of your patrollers, allowing your opponent to summon Jaina who potentially can deal lethal damage
  • Making sure Midori can’t fly over your patrol and kill you directly
  • Setting up your board and deck so that you have lethal damage next turn, even through a second Moment’s Peace

I think an interesting twist on this puzzle could be with you having the same board state, except for also having a Newsman in play (on an irrelevant number like 4). Then, after deciding what to tech, you have to play Lawful Search to see their hand. Their hand contains something like [Pillage, Moment’s Peace, Flame Arrow, 2 other cards], so you have to flicker the Newsman with Geiger to stop Pillage, then patrol so that Midori can’t fly over for lethal or suicide to bring in Jaina as well. Maybe they even rebuilt their Heroes’ Hall, so you have to find a way to break that this turn too. While doing all this, you also have to still find a way to set up lethal for your next turn through the next Moment’s Peace that you know is coming.
